Let the Voting Begin!

As our local election day neared we have been talking about voting in class. We discussed how important voting is and how individuals can help make big decisions for the community by voting. However, bonds and city ordinances don't mean much to kindergartners so we voted on something a little more age appropriate...

Who is telling the truth? The 3 Little Pigs or The Wolf? We read books narrated by each character and voted using ballots.

Once the votes were all in we tallied our responses & made a graph.

Drum roll please............. The wolf won by 1 vote! None of the kids had heard the wolf's version of the story and were pretty impressed with his soft side.
